SUMMARY
Boomerang mis-recognizes the guest OS of VMs and I cannot select those VMs
ISSUE
Boomerang relies on the guest OS settings to recognize the guest OS running in each VM. If Boomerang does not allow for selecting VMs on creating a Protection Group even when the actual guest OS is in the list of supported OSes, please check the guest OS set in VMware is correctly set.
You can make changes to Guest OS Version from vSphere Client if you are certain the Operating System in your VM is compatible.
